快乐赛车 > 应用 > 模拟技术
[导读]电路仿真软件必不可少,很多朋友早已精通各种电路仿真软件,但也存在很多朋友对电路仿真软件不太了解。本文是电路仿真软件的进阶篇,对于电路仿真软件的基础篇,大家可翻阅往期文章哦。本文中,将基于proteus电路仿真软件的步进电机仿真,一起来了解下吧。

电路仿真软件必不可少,很多朋友早已精通各种电路仿真软件,但也存在很多朋友对电路仿真软件不太了解。本文是电路仿真软件的进阶篇,对于电路仿真软件的基础篇,大家可翻阅往期文章哦。本文中,将基于proteus电路仿真软件的步进电机仿真,一起来了解下吧。

步进电机广泛应用在生产实践的各个领域。它最大的应用是在数控机床的制造中,因为步进电机不需要A/D转换,能够直接将数字脉冲信号转化成为角位移,所以被认为是理想的数控机床的执行元件。本设计利用proteus仿真软件进行电路仿真,系统通过设置四个按键分别控制不进电机的起止、圈数、方向、不进速度,使用1602液晶显示以上参数。整个系统具有稳定性好,实用性强,操作界面友好等优点。

步进电机是一种将电脉冲转变为角位移的执行机构,可通过控制脉冲数来控制角位移量。步进电机广泛应用在生产实践的各个领域。它最大的应用是在数控机床的制造中,因为步进电机不需要A/D转换,能够直接将数字脉冲信号转化成为角位移,所以被认为是理想的数控机床的执行元件。

一、 Proteus简介

Proteus ISIS是英国Labcenter公司开发的电路分析与实物仿真软件。它运行于Windows操作系统上,可以仿真、分析(SPICE)各种模拟器件和集成电路,该软件的特点是:

①实现了单片机仿真和SPICE电路仿真相结合。具有模拟电路仿真、数字电路仿真、单片机及其外围电路组成的系统的仿真、RS232动态仿真、I2C调试器、SPI调试器、键盘和LCD系统仿真的功能;有各种虚拟仪器,如示波器、逻辑分析仪、信号发生器等。

②支持主流单片机系统的仿真。目前支持的单片机类型有:68000系列、8051系列、AVR系列、PIC12系列、PIC16系列、PIC18系列、Z80系列、HC11系列以及各种外围芯片。

③提供软件调试功能。在硬件仿真系统中具有全速、单步、设置断点等调试功能,同时可以观察各个变量、寄存器等的当前状态,因此在该软件仿真系统中,也必须具有这些功能;同时支持第三方的软件编译和调试环境,如Keil C51 uVision2等软件。

④具有强大的原理图绘制功能。总之,该软件是一款集单片机和SPICE分析于一身的仿真软件,功能极其强大。

二、整体电路分析

如下图,整个设计以STC89C51单片机为中心,由复位电路,时钟电路,电机驱动,步进电机,显示电路等组成,硬件模块如图2-1所示:

image1.jpg

通过按键进行相应的参数设定,单片机接收到信号后经过判断驱动电机驱动模块,然后由驱动电路驱动步进电机运转,并用1602显示设置的参数。

三、系统硬件电路选择与设计

1、主控器的选择

按照题目要求本次主控单元使用C51单片机对整个系统进行控制。STC89C51RC包含512字节RAM 、32条I/O口线、3个16位定时/计数器、8输入4优先级嵌套中断结构、1个串行I/O口(可用于多机通信、I/O扩展或全双工UART)以及片内振荡器和时钟电路。此外,由于器件采用了静态设计,可提供很宽的操作频率范围(频率可降至0)。可实现两个由软件选择的节电模式、空闲模式和掉电模式。空闲模式冻结CPU,但RAM、定时器、串口和中断系统仍然工作。掉电模式保存RAM的内容,但是冻结振荡器,导致所有其它的片内功能停止工作。由于设计是静态的,时钟可停止而不会丢失用户数据。运行可从时钟停止处恢复。所以该单片机可以满足系统要求,电路图如下:

image2.jpg

2、步进电机选择

步进电机是一种能够将电脉冲信号转换成角位移或线位移的机电元件,它实际上是一种单相或多相同步电动机。单相步进电动机有单路电脉冲驱动,输出功率一般很小,其用途为微小功率驱动。多相步进电动机有多相方波脉冲驱动,用途很广。本设计使用的是四相三拍步进电机,连接图如下:

image3.jpg

3、驱动电路的选择

驱动模块我们使用集成驱动芯片ULN2003,给芯片是高耐压、大电流达林顿管由七个硅NPN 达林顿管组成。该电路的特点如下:ULN2003 的每一对达林顿都串联一个2.7K 的基极电阻,在5V 的工作电压下它能与TTL 和CMOS 电路直接相连,可以直接处理原先需要标准逻辑缓冲器来处理的数据。ULN2003 工作电压高,工作电流大,灌电流可达500mA,并且能够在关态时承受50V 的电压,输出还可以在高负载电流并行运行。1脚输入,16脚输出,你的负载接在VCC与16脚之间,不用9脚。

image4.jpg

ULN2003是大电流驱动阵列,多用于单片机、智能仪表、PLC、数字量输出卡等控制电路中。可直接驱动继电器等负载。所以足以满足驱动步进电机的要求,连接图如下:

image5.jpg

4、显示电路的

LCD显示模块是把LCD显示屏、背景光源、线路 板和驱动集成电路等部件构造成1个整体作为1个独 立部件使用,只留1个接口与外部通信。显示模块通 过这个接口接收显示的命令和数据,并按指令和数据 的要求进行显示,外部电路通过这个接口读出显示模 块的工作状态和显示数据。1602液晶模块内部的字 符发生存储器(CGROM)已经存储了160个不同的点阵字符图形,这些字符有:阿拉伯数字、英文字母的大 小写、常用的符号和日文假名等,每1个字符都有1个 固定的代码。用户对模块写入适当的控制命令,即可 完成清屏、显示、地址设置等操作 。设计采用并行方式控制,LCD与单片机的通讯接口电路如图3所示采用直连的方法。

image6.jpg

5键盘输入模块电路

设计中,键盘采用非编码键盘系统中的独立式按 键结构。键盘工作方式采用定时扫描方式。采用定时 器TO定时,通过输出数据,识别按键的工作状态。键 盘主要用来提供人机接口,电路如图3所示,采用独立 式按键电路,各按键开关均采用了上拉电阻,保证在按 键断开时,各I/O有确定的高电平。按键功定义如 下:当P3.2按下时,步进电机开始加速;当P3.3按下 时,步进电机开始减速;当P3.4按下时,步进电机开始 正转;当P3.5按下时,步进电机开始反转。按键抖动的消除采用软件消抖实现。连接图如下:

image7.jpg

以上便是此次小编带来的“电路仿真软件”相关内容,通过本文,希望大家对本文讲解的内容具备一定的认知。如果你喜欢本文,不妨持续关注我们网站哦,小编将于后期带来更多精彩内容。最后,十分感谢大家的阅读,have a nice day!

换一批

延伸阅读

[模拟技术] 电路仿真软件详谈(十九),基于proteus电路仿真软件的交通灯控制电路设计

电路仿真软件详谈(十九),基于proteus电路仿真软件的交通灯控制电路设计

电路仿真软件是当代重要软件之一,缺乏电路仿真软件,模拟运行环境将无法搭建。对于电路仿真软件,虽然市面上类别众多,但知名电路仿真软件为proteus。针对这款电路仿真软件,小编曾带来诸多介绍。本文对于电路仿真软件的介绍,为基于proteus的......

关键字:电路仿真软件 proteus 交通灯控制电路

[模拟技术] 电路仿真软件详谈(十八),基于proteus电路仿真软件的定位系统仿真

电路仿真软件详谈(十八),基于proteus电路仿真软件的定位系统仿真

电路仿真软件具备电路仿真能力,市场流通的每款电路仿真软件均具备自身特点。本文针对电路仿真软件的讲解,将采用protues。而针对其它电路仿真软件,大家可百度了解。本文撰写目的在于向大家介绍,如何使用protues电路仿真软件实现定位系统的仿......

关键字:电路仿真软件 proteus 定位系统

[模拟技术] 电路仿真软件详谈(十七),基于proteus电路仿真软件的自动取款机实现

电路仿真软件详谈(十七),基于proteus电路仿真软件的自动取款机实现

电路仿真软件应用意义较强,对于电路仿真软件,小编曾带来诸多介绍。目前,市场上流通较广的电路仿真软件为Proteus、multisim以及ltspice。本文对于电路仿真软件的讲解基于protues,主要内容在于将于如何使用该电路仿真软件实现......

关键字:电路仿真软件 proteus 自动取款机

[模拟技术] 电路仿真软件详谈(十六),proteus电路仿真软件之源码调试

电路仿真软件详谈(十六),proteus电路仿真软件之源码调试

电路仿真软件主要目的在于仿真,目前最为知名的电路仿真软件之一为proteus,因此本文对于电路仿真软件的讲解基于该软件。对于proteus电路仿真软件,小编也带来相应介绍。但为增加大家对proteus电路仿真软件的实用能力,在本文中,将为大......

关键字:电路仿真软件 proteus 源码调试

[模拟技术] 电路仿真软件详谈(十五),proteus电路仿真软件汉字点阵设计

电路仿真软件详谈(十五),proteus电路仿真软件汉字点阵设计

电路仿真软件是很多朋友均会涉及的应用软件,其中使用最多的为proteus电路仿真软件。为增进大家对电路仿真软件的了解,小编曾基于proteus电路仿真软件带来过实际应用教程。同样,本文基于proteus电路仿真软件,将对汉字点阵显示电路予以......

关键字:电路仿真软件 proteus 汉字点阵

[模拟技术] 电路仿真软件详谈(十四),proteus电路仿真软件LED设计、仿真

电路仿真软件详谈(十四),proteus电路仿真软件LED设计、仿真

电路仿真软件是大家常用软件之一,对于电路仿真软件的学习,诸多朋友仅停留于理论阶段。为提高大家于电路仿真软件的动手能力,本文将基于proteus电路仿真软件,带来LED滚屏设计与仿真。如果你对电路仿真软件存在一定兴趣,不妨继续往下阅读哦。......

关键字:电路仿真软件 proteus LED

[模拟技术] 电路仿真软件详谈(十三),proteus电路仿真软件常见问题总结

电路仿真软件详谈(十三),proteus电路仿真软件常见问题总结

电路仿真软件是工程应用必备软件之一,其中proteus乃当前最常使用的电路仿真软件。但学习proteus电路仿真软件过程中,难免遇到诸多问题。为增进大家对电路仿真软件的了解,本文将对proteus电路仿真软件常见问题加以总结,让我们一起来了......

关键字:电路仿真软件 proteus 常见问题

[工业控制] 如何选好一款合适的电路仿真软件

如何选好一款合适的电路仿真软件

电路仿真,顾名思义就是设计好的电路图通过仿真软件进行实时模拟,模拟出实际功能,然后通过其分析改进,从而实现电路的优化设计。是EDA(电子设计自动化)的一部分。 ......

关键字:电路仿真 电路仿真软件

[模拟技术] 电路仿真软件详谈(十二),proteus电路仿真软件的SPI实例

电路仿真软件详谈(十二),proteus电路仿真软件的SPI实例

对于电路仿真软件,小编曾介绍过诸多相关内容,如电路仿真软件proteus的优点、电路仿真软件proteus与protel的区别、采用proteus电路仿真软件绘制PCB等。本文中,同样以proteus电路仿真软件为依托,为大家讲解基于pro。。。。。。

关键字:电路仿真软件 proteus SPI

[模拟技术] 电路仿真软件详谈(十一),proteus电路仿真软件的音乐演奏系统的实现

电路仿真软件详谈(十一),proteus电路仿真软件的音乐演奏系统的实现

电路仿真软件在现实中的应用较为广泛,学习电路仿真软件的朋友也越来越多。其中,大多学习者以proteus电路仿真软件为学习工具。因此,本文以该电路仿真软件为基础,为大家带来一份电路仿真软件设计实例。如果你对本文内容存在一定兴趣,不妨继续往下阅......

关键字:电路仿真软件 proteus 实例

[模拟技术] 电路仿真软件详谈(十),proteus电路仿真软件排阻操作

电路仿真软件详谈(十),proteus电路仿真软件排阻操作

电路仿真软件有很多,其中以proteus电路仿真软件为主。对于这款电路仿真软件,相信很多朋友都比较熟悉。本文中,同样以proteus电路仿真软件为依托,为大家讲解如何在这款电路仿真软件中寻找排阻。如果你对本文的内容存在一定兴趣,不妨继续往下。。。。。。

关键字:电路仿真软件 proteus 排阻

[模拟技术] 电路仿真软件详谈(九),proteus电路仿真软件及版本问题

电路仿真软件详谈(九),proteus电路仿真软件及版本问题

电路仿真软件用途广泛,可哪款电路仿真软件功能最为强大呢?对于这个问题,想必诸多朋友第一反应想到proteus电路仿真软件。众所周知,proteus是电路仿真软件界的实力佼佼者。但proteus电路仿真软件的版本着实很多,令很多朋友无法抉择。......

关键字:proteus 电路仿真软件 版本

[模拟技术] 电路仿真软件详谈(八),proteus电路仿真软件和protel的区别

电路仿真软件详谈(八),proteus电路仿真软件和protel的区别

电路仿真软件是常用工具类型之一,proteus更是电路仿真软件中的佼佼者。但是对于proteus电路仿真软件和protel,二者总是被弄混淆。例如,protel是电路仿真软件吗?proteus电路仿真软件必须依赖于protel吗?对于类似的......

关键字:proteus 电路仿真软件 protel

[模拟技术] 电路仿真软件详谈(七),proteus电路仿真软件优点+仿真浅析

电路仿真软件详谈(七),proteus电路仿真软件优点+仿真浅析

电路仿真软件是工作得力助手之一,但目前流行度高的电路仿真软件并非很多。几大优秀电路仿真软件中,proteus更是受到诸多青睐。对于这款电路仿真软件,你知道它的优点和仿真过程吗?不知道的话,继续浏览这篇电路仿真软件proteus的介绍吧。......

关键字:proteus 电路仿真软件 仿真

[模拟技术] 电路仿真软件详谈(六),Proteus电路仿真软件的超级应用

电路仿真软件详谈(六),Proteus电路仿真软件的超级应用

一款优秀的电路仿真软件,可帮助用户更好实现相应功能,而Proteus电路仿真软件便是这样一款利器。本文中,将讲解基于Proteus电路仿真软件的SPI接口的设计与实现。通过本文,希望大家对Proteus电路仿真软件的应用具备深层次的理解。......

关键字:电路仿真软件 Proteus SPI

我 要 评 论

网友评论

技术子站

更多

项目外包

推荐博客

欢乐生肖 欢乐生肖 欢乐生肖 德国时时彩 江苏快三质合走势图 亚洲彩票 澳彩网彩票注册 易中彩票注册 秒速时时彩 彩票高賠率好平台